Understanding the Casino Business: An Overview
At its core, the casino business involves providing gamblers with a variety of gambling games and entertainment options. These establishments range from large-scale resorts with integrated hotel and entertainment facilities to smaller card rooms and online platforms. The primary revenue streams include house edges from games such as blackjack, roulette, poker, and slot machines, alongside ancillary services like hospitality, retail outlets, and entertainment events.
The Economic Impact of Casinos Worldwide
Casinos serve as major catalysts for economic growth in many regions. They generate employment, stimulate tourism, and contribute significantly to local and national budgets through taxes and licensing fees. For instance, Las Vegas alone accounts for billions of dollars annually, creating thousands of jobs and fueling an entire ecosystem of hospitality, retail, and entertainment businesses.
Moreover, countries in Asia, such as Singapore, Macau, and South Korea, have experienced exponential growth in the sector, positioning themselves as global gambling hubs. This expansion has led to increased infrastructure development, international investment, and regional economic integration.

Legal and Regulatory Landscape in the Casino Sector
Navigating the legal environment is paramount for casino operators. Regulatory frameworks vary considerably across jurisdictions, affecting licensing, taxation, and operational standards. A stringent regulatory environment ensures fair play and prevents illegal activities, but excessive regulation can hinder growth. Conversely, regions offering favorable laws and incentives attract more investors and operators.
Industry stakeholders must maintain compliance with anti-money laundering policies, responsible gambling initiatives, and consumer protection laws to sustain their license and reputation.

Challenges Facing the Casino Industry
Despite its growth prospects, the industry must navigate several challenges:
- Regulatory Uncertainty: Changes in legislation can impact operations and profitability.
- Problem Gambling and Responsible Gaming: Ensuring ethical practices and supporting vulnerable players are critical for sustainability and reputation management.
- Economic Fluctuations: Economic downturns can reduce discretionary spending on gambling activities.
- Health and Safety Concerns: Especially relevant in the context of global health crises, requiring adaptive measures and contingency planning.
